Wall tile repair services involve fixing damaged, cracked, or deteriorating tiles on interior or exterior walls. Over time, tiles can become loose, chipped, or stained due to everyday wear and tear, moisture exposure, or accidental impacts. Skilled contractors evaluate the condition of existing tiles and determine the best approach to restore their appearance and functionality. Repair options may include re-adhering loose tiles, filling in cracks or chips, replacing broken tiles, or sealing grout lines to prevent further damage. These services help maintain the visual appeal of a space while ensuring the wall remains structurally sound.
Many common problems can be addressed through wall tile repair. Cracks and chips often occur in kitchens, bathrooms, or laundry rooms where moisture and frequent use can weaken tile surfaces. Mold or mildew buildup in grout lines can also compromise the integrity of tiled walls. Additionally, tiles may loosen or fall off entirely, exposing underlying wall surfaces to damage. Repairing these issues not only improves the appearance of the space but also prevents more costly repairs down the line, such as replacing entire wall sections or dealing with water damage.

The overview below groups typical Wall Tile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rosemount,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wall tile repairs in Rosemount often range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, like replacing a few cracked tiles, fall within this middle price band. Fewer projects reach the higher end of the spectrum unless multiple or complex repairs are needed.
Moderate Projects - Larger repairs such as re-grouting or patching extensive areas usually c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for homeowners updating or fixing multiple sections of wall tile. Larger, more involved repairs can push costs higher but remain within typical ranges.
Full Wall Replacement - Replacing entire sections or walls of wall tile can range from $1,200 to $3,500 depending on size and tile type.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, though more elaborate or custom installations may increase the cost significantly.
Complete Renovations - Full bathroom or kitchen wall tile renovations, involving extensive removal and new installation, often start around $5,000 and can exceed $10,000 for larger, complex projects. These are less common but represent the upper tier of typical costs for comprehensive upgrades in Rosemount area homes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wall tile damage can be repaired? Local contractors can handle various issues such as cracks, chips, loose tiles, and grout deterioration on wall surfaces.
Is wall tile repair suitable for all tile materials? Most service providers can repair or replace tiles made of ceramic, porcelain, glass, or stone to restore their appearance and functionality.
Can wall tile repairs be integrated with existing tile designs? Yes, experienced contractors can match new tiles with existing patterns and colors to maintain a cohesive look.
What are common causes of wall tile damage? Damage often results from impacts, water exposure, shifting structures, or improper installation over time.
How do local service providers assess wall tile repair needs? They typically evaluate the extent of damage, the tile type, and the underlying surface to recommend appropriate repair solutions.
